What are some common challenges faced by C++ developers in large-scale enterprise projects?

C++ developers working on large-scale enterprise projects often encounter challenges such as managing complex codebases, ensuring code quality, and maintaining performance across different platforms. They also need to work closely with cross-functional teams, including QA, DevOps, and product managers, which requires strong communication skills. Keeping up with evolving C++ standards and integrating legacy systems with modern architectures are additional hurdles. Proactive collaboration and continuous learning are essential to overcome these challenges and advance within C++ development teams.

Job description

Provides direct student counseling services and individual student case management to ensure student progress, retention and completion of the Job Corps program. Identifies and remediates student barriers to success and develops individualized student career plans. Ensures strict confidentiality of sensitive information and integrity of student data.

Bachelors degree from an accredited school (including at least 15 semester hours in Social Services-related instruction) required. A minimum of one-year experience in counseling or related field. Prefer previous Job Corps or related program experience. Must possess a valid Drivers License and meet company insurability requirements.


May provide supervision and oversight of the CPP program and staff.

o Follows all integrity guidelines and procedures and ensures no manipulation of student data.
o Ensures student case load meets or exceeds DOL/Company performance goals.
o Responsible to provide students with comprehensive and individualized case management ensuring student progress, retention and completion of the Job Corps program. Establishes supportive/mentoring relationships with students throughout their enrollment and provides personal, educational and career counseling.
o Collaborates with Residential Counseling staff to provide comprehensive student case management services.
o Takes an active role in ensuring case management and career management teams are effective systems to ensure student success in the program.
o Ensures students are actively engaged in social development, leadership and independent living skills and other related after-hours programming that promotes achievement and success.
o Oversees and manages student progress evaluations, weekly student career success ratings and assessment/evaluation conferences. Ensures quality, timely case notes are entered as needed and required.
o Provides ongoing assessment of student progress in Academics, Career Technical and Independent Living.
o Develops and updates student Personal Career Development Plans.
o Coordinates services for students (on-Center and off-Center) to ensure student retention and success in the program. Transports students as needed/required.
